SHEELY, P. J., March 18, 1960.

The question presented in this case is whether a support order entered in a proceeding commenced under section 733 of The Penal Code of June 24, 1939, P. L. 872, 18 PS §4733, may be amended by petition so as to include support for a child born to defendant and relatrix after the entry of the order, and possibily increased to provide for such child.
